The Blue Book of Chess, authored by chess pioneer Howard Staunton, is a seminal work that has significantly influenced the world of chess literature since its publication in the 19th century. Recognized for its structured approach to the game, this book intricately blends theoretical insights with practical advice for players of all levels. Staunton meticulously covers opening strategies, middle-game tactics, and endgame principles, providing readers with a comprehensive understanding of chess mechanics.Renowned for his mastery and contribution to chess, Staunton’s writing is both accessible and authoritative. His work not only showcases classic games and notable strategies but also touches upon the psychological elements of gameplay. The book’s elegant prose and clear explanations have made it a valuable resource for generations of chess enthusiasts. The Blue Book of Chess remains a timeless reference that continues to inspire players, cementing Staunton's legacy as a cornerstone in the realm of chess education.
